Abstract

The scheelitetype structure of potassium periodate. KIO4, has been confirmed and refined from single-crystal X-ray data at two temperatures. The compound crystallizes tetragonally, space group I4(1)/a, with a = 5.726(1), c = 12.607(4) A at 297(1) K, and a = 5.704(3), c = 12.478(8) Angstrom at 150(1) K, respectively. Except for a significant decrease in the anisotropic displacement factors, the changes in the structural parameters at low temperature are rather small.
